day 16 young men part 2

I write to you, young men,

Because you have overcome the wicked one.



I have written to you, young men, Because you are strong, and the word of God abides in you, And you have overcome the wicked one.

we ended part 1 with a focus on one of the two characteristics that St. John brings up. I talked about the mature believer's strength. now I'm going to talk about a new trait.


The other characteristic of this more mature believer is the word of God abiding in them. The importance of the word of God cannot be stated enough. The word is a foundation for every believer’s life. It is the light which illuminates the path of life. By I can see the enemy’s pitfalls and avoid them. John 12:46 says that following Jesus keeps us from remaining in darkness. Luke 8:21 – those who hear the word of God and do it are those who are closest to Jesus

Luke 11:21 – those who hear the word and keep it are blessed

Acts 6:1-7 – as the word increased then the church multiplied in growth

Acts 19:5-20 – here Paul and his company labor by spreading the word of God. They are so effective that within two years every one in the province of Asia had heard the gospel. The end result it that God’s word brought people to repentance and into maturity.

As we have already read in Ephesians 6:17 the sword of the Spirit is the word of God. This word of God is most powerful indeed. Hebrews 4:12

For the word of God is living and active. Sharper than any double-edged sword, it penetrates even to dividing soul and spirit, joints and marrow; it judges the thoughts and attitudes of the heart.

The word of God is living and active. This is the power that is in the “young men”. Listen you cannot live a life that honors our God apart from his word. This word is to read on a regular basis. It is not only to be read but obeyed. If the word says it then adjust your life and thoughts accordingly.

The difference between a baby Christian and a more mature one has to do with the word. Getting the word into you is so important for maturity. You have to take it in and let it spread to your whole body. It has to affect your thoughts, your deeds and you words. Without a firm foundation in the entire word of God, not just the New Testament, you are easy prey for the devil and evil people. You will be led astray. You will be deceived.

St. John says that these young men have overcome the wicked one. Just imagine the feeling of knowing the devil is overcome. Jesus demonstrated the significance of abiding in the word and the word abiding in us during his temptation. Jesus could have used power to vanquish the devil but he chose God’s word. Three times he as tempted and three times he answered it is written. Our ability to see the devil defeated in our lives rests in the word of God.

How we need people today who are able to uncompromisingly teach God’s holy word. We need to encourage our fellow believers, regardless of their level of maturity to get into the word. We should be known as the generation of doers of the word of God.
